Please see below for an update on our Childcare services:
“YMCA Childcare would like to wish all their children and families a Merry Christmas and a Happy New Year. We wish you all health and happiness as you celebrate this wonderful time of the year.
As COVID-19 is not going to go away during the Christmas period, we ask that if your child becomes unwell and subsequently tests positive over the break, please can you contact nurseryadmin@ymcatrinity.org.uk and inform us of your child’s name, age, Childcare site attended and the date that your child tested positive. This will allow us to contact any other families who may have had contact with your child so that they can isolate themselves, or have a test too.
Please can all parents ensure we have the correct contact number for you over this period, as we may need to contact you and inform you of a positive case in another child who has had contact with your child too.
Thank you for your continued support through what has been a challenging year, here’s to a better 2021.”

YMCA Trinity Group is part of a federation of over 116 YMCAs across England and Wales. Our vision is to help create supportive, inclusive and transforming communities where young people can truly belong, contribute and thrive.
